Web and Digital Interface Designers Salary in New Jersey
SOC 15-1255 · New Jersey · BLS OEWS May 2024
The median salary for Web and Digital Interface Designers in New Jersey is $87,069 per year ($41.86/hr). This is 11.2% lower than the national median of $98,093. The middle 50% earn between $68,806 and $124,051 annually. Top earners at the 90th percentile reach $168,813.
Wage Percentiles: New Jersey
| Percentile | Hourly Rate | Annual Salary | vs National |
|---|---|---|---|
| P10 | $26.95 | $56,056 | +17.2% |
| P25 | $33.08 | $68,806 | +5.9% |
| P50MEDIAN | $41.86 | $87,069 | -11.2% |
| P75 | $59.64 | $124,051 | -12.6% |
| P90 | $81.16 | $168,813 | -12.2% |
